OPEN MOUTH, INSERT FOOT....


I think we all have learned the hard way that you don't assume a woman is pregnant and ask her when she is due. Well, here's another life lesson for you. The other day, two older-ish women came to the jewelry counter in search of the perfect gold band. At first I thought it was for one of them, but of course, didn't say anything like "so how long have you two been together?" even though I was thinking it. As time went on I caught on that it was a gift for someone else. They deliberated for quite some time, "I like this one, it's wider, I think she'll like this one, does she want yellow gold or white gold? thicker band or thinner?" They were close to deciding when I piped up and said; "Well, if she doesn't like it she can always bring it back and trade it for what she wants." To which they both replied in unison; "Oh, she's dead." 'Oh, I'm so sorry..'. Yeah, it was for their mother who had just passed away, to be burried in. Hello! what do you say to that?!!!! So, learn from my gastly experience; don't ever assume....ANYTHING...
